Attaching to Specific Instances of the IDE


when I do:

// Get an instance of the currently running Visual Studio IDE.
EnvDTE80.DTE2 dte2;
dte2 = (EnvDTE80.DTE2)System.Runtime.InteropServices.Marshal.
GetActiveObject("VisualStudio.DTE.10.0");

var solution = dte2.Solution; // get solution

Console.WriteLine(solution.FullName);  // prints the name of the solution where this code is written

I am able to get an instance of the current ide

I will like to get a reference to dte2 of a different visual studio instance though. This link states that it is possible to do that. As a result I have tried something like:

    Process p = new Process();
    ProcessStartInfo ps = new ProcessStartInfo(@"C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Visual Studio 10.0\Common7\IDE\devenv.exe");
    p.StartInfo = ps;
    p.Start(); // start a new instance of visual studio

    var ROT = "!VisualStudio.DTE.10.0:" + p.Id;

    // Get an instance of the NEW instance of Visual Studio IDE.
    EnvDTE80.DTE2 dte2;
    dte2 = (EnvDTE80.DTE2)System.Runtime.InteropServices.Marshal.
    GetActiveObject(ROT); 

If I try that I get the exception:

Invalid class string (Exception from HRESULT: 0x800401F3 (CO_E_CLASSSTRING))

Solution

  • One thing that has worked for me consistently is

    var dte = GetDTE();
    var debugger = dte.Debugger;
    var processes = debugger.LocalProcesses;
    int processIdToAttach; //your process id of second visual studio
    foreach (var p in processes)
    {
        EnvDTE90.Process3 process3 = (EnvDTE90.Process3)p;
        if (process3.ProcessID == processIdToAttach)
        {
            if (!process3.IsBeingDebugged)
            {
                if (doMixedModeDebugging)
                {
                    string[] arr = new string[] { "Managed", "Native" };
                    process3.Attach2(arr);
                }
                else
                {
                    process3.Attach();
                }
            }
            break;
        }
    }
